Daniel Bwala Claims Media is Plotting Against Him
Daniel Bwala, the newly appointed Special Adviser on Media and Public Communications, has raised alarm about what he believes to be a conspiracy against him by certain television guests and anchors. In a post on X (formerly Twitter) on Saturday, Bwala expressed frustration over what he described as an “overwhelming conspiracy” but did not name any specific individuals involved. He urged his followers to pray, claiming that his faith would expose those behind the alleged plot.
Bwala’s appointment, which took place on November 14, has sparked mixed reactions within political circles, especially given his previous role as the spokesperson for the 2023 PDP Presidential Campaign. His shift to a key position in the administration of President Bola Tinubu, representing the ruling APC, has led to significant debate.
Shortly after taking office, Bwala made headlines by claiming to have replaced Ajuri Ngelale as the official spokesman for the president. However, the presidency later issued a clarification, stating that Bwala’s role was that of “Special Adviser Policy Communication,” not spokesperson.
